Suchergebnisse für Anfrage "gdb"

2 die antwort

GDB: So entfernen Sie eine Variable aus der automatischen Anzeige

Ich bin auf die Auto-Display-Funktionalität von gdb gestoßen, die ziemlich leistungsfähig und praktisch ist. Nach dem Aufruf von (gdb) display/i $pc (gdb) display $raxdie beobachteten Werte werden nach jedem Schritt automatisch angezeigt: (gdb) ...

6 die antwort

calling operator << in gdb

Wie rufst du @ operator<<(std::ostream &os, const ClassX &x) von innen gdb? Mit anderen Worten, wie druckt man ein Objekt in GDB? call std::cout<<x odercall operator<<(std::cout, x) scheint nicht für mich zu arbeiten! Irgendwelche Ideen

8 die antwort

wie benutzt man gdb um den Stack / Heap zu erkunden?

Kann mir jemand einen kurzen Überblick geben / mich auf die Dokumentation einer Möglichkeit hinweisen, den Stapel (und den Haufen?) Eines C-Programms zu untersuchen? Ich dachte, das sollte mit GDB gemacht werden, aber wenn es andere geradlinigere ...

TOP-Veröffentlichungen

2 die antwort

Wie wird der Haltepunkt mithilfe von GDB für x86-Assembly festgelegt, wenn keine Symbolinformationen vorhanden sind? [Duplikat

Diese Frage hat hier bereits eine Antwort: Bei der ersten Maschinencode-Anweisung in GDB anhalten [/questions/10483544/stopping-at-the-first-machine-code-instruction-in-gdb] 5 AntwortenWie setze ich einen Haltepunkt mit GDB für x86-Assemblycode, ...

4 die antwort

gdb friert in malloc @ e

Angenommen, ich habe ein C-Programm wie dieses: #include <stdlib.h> #include <stdbool.h> int main() { while (true) { void *p = malloc(1000); free(p); } return 0; }und ich hänge es mit @ gdb so wasgdb a.out PID. gdb verbindet sich erfolgreich ...

8 die antwort

Variablenname, Funktionsargumente zur Laufzeit in C

Ist es möglich, die Namenstypen von Funktionsargumenten und Variablen zur Laufzeit in C-Programmen zu kennen? Zum Beispiel, wenn ich eine Funktion habe: int abc(int x, float y , somestruct z ){ char a; int b ; }Kann ich in dieser Funktion ...

4 die antwort

Wie kann ich jonesforth mit GDB debuggen?

jonesforth wird normalerweise wie folgt gestartet: cat jonesforth.f - | ./jonesforth Was ist ein guter Weg, um zu debuggenjonesforth?

16 die antwort

GDB Art funktioniert nicht auf MacOS Sierra

Es ist ein Problem, das aufgetreten ist, als ich gestern zum ersten Mal auf macOS Sierra aktualisiert habe. GDB selbst läuft in Ordnung. Irgendwie kann mein Programm jedoch nicht ausgeführt werden. Wenn ich 'run' und 'enter' eingebe, stürzt es ...

6 die antwort

gdb beendet mit Signal?, unbekanntes Signal

Ich versuche nur, Code mit gdb unter Mac OS X Version 10.12 zu debuggen, erhalte jedoch immer diesen unbekannten Fehler, wenn ich mein Programm in gdb starte. Ich habe die GDB nach der Installation mit einem Code versehen und meinen Code mit ...

2 die antwort

[Emacs] [GDB-Anpassung] Wie wird der Quellpuffer in einem Fenster angezeigt?

Ich habe GDB-Fenster in Emacs angepasst. Danach öffnet sich beim Debuggen neuer Quellcode in verschiedenen Fenstern. Ich möchte den Quellcode nur in einem Fenster sehen. Meine GDB-Anpassung ...